Focusing on the themes of learning and scholarship, this book explores the educational landscape of Ireland and the experiences of Irish scholars. It delves into historical contexts and the impact of education on society, particularly within the framework of Catholicism. Originally published in 1890, it spans 666 pages and covers various subjects, including history and juvenile fiction related to school and education.
